Maamannan
Box
Office
Collection
Day
7
Prediction:
Vadivelu
starrer
is
nearing
50
crores
at
the
worldwide
box
office
in
just
7
days
of
its
release.
Here
is
the
day-wise
box
office
collection
(India)
of
Maamannan:
Day
1:
Rs
8.5
Crore
Day
2:
Rs
5.1
Crore
Day
3:
Rs
7
Crore
Day
4:
Rs
7.8
Crore
Day
5:
Rs
2.9
Crore
Day
6:
Rs
2.7
Crore
Day
7:
Rs
2.59
Crore
(Early
Estimates)
Total
7
Days
Collection:
Rs
36.59
Crore
(Early
Estimates)
Vadivelu
Era
It
is
not
possible
for
everyone
to
see
an
art
become
life
in
blood.
Vadivelu,
who
was
brought
in
to
narrate
the
story
to
accompany
actor
Rajkiran
in
his
spare
time,
made
his
debut
in
Rajkiran's
En
Raasaavin
Manasiniley
and
became
the
comedy
emperor
of
Tamil
cinema.
Having
proved
his
mettle
in
films
like
Singaravelan,
Thevar
Magan
and
Ponnumani,
Vadivelu
proved
that
he
can
carry
a
separate
comedy
track.
Vadivelu
acted
in
more
than
a
hundred
films
in
the
first
10
years
of
his
acting
debut.
The
early
2000
hit
film
Vetri
Kodi
Kattu
earned
Vadivelu
a
huge
fan
base
all
over
the
world.
After
this
Vadivelu
made
a
mark
in
every
movie
to
the
extent
that
Vadivelu
was
the
main
reason
for
the
success
of
the
movie.
After
the
failure
of
Baba,
Superstar
Rajinikanth
decided
to
act
in
Chandramukhi,
and
Vadivelu
was
roped
into
play
the
comedian
in
the
film
with
many
interesting
comedy
sequences
with
Rajinikanth
that
worked
big
and
brought
a
great
success
at
box
office.
Proper
Comeback
With
Maamannan
Every
Vadivelu
films
till
2011's
Kaavalan
with
Vijay
was
talked
about
for
him.
During
this
period
Vadivelu,
who
jumped
into
the
political
arena,
campaigned
against
Vijayakanth
and
the
failure
of
the
DMK
alliance
supported
by
Vadivelu
kept
him
stay
back
at
home
for
some
years.
Even
thoug
he
acted
in
a
few
films
later,
he
couldn't
taste
the
success
due
to
the
poor
choice
of
scripts.
In
such
a
situation,
Vadivel
made
the
fans
emotional
in
Mamannan,
directed
by
Mari
Selvaraj
and
starring
Udayanidhi
stalin.
Fans
hails
Vadivelu
in
a
completely
different
role,
a
comeback
they
hadn't
seen
in
two
decades.
